Job Summary:

The Sr. E3D Model Manager will be responsible for developing and maintaining the E3D project catalogs and specifications as well as assisting the design team in preparing layouts and design of complex offshore piping design systems utilizing Company 2D and 3D modeling software.

Job Duties and Responsibilities:
Create and maintain E3D catalogs;
Create and maintain Project E3D specifications;
Assist the design team in resolving CAD software issues and user issues;
Ensure that there are no internal & external software integration problems;
Conduct software training;
Coordinate with project teams on determining and addressing project priorities;
Interact with employees and clients on project and CAD related issues;
Assist in preparing layouts and Engineering drawings for assigned projects from information and/or verbal instructions with little or no supervision required;
Ensure that all drawings adhere to Client, Industry and Company Standards;
Responsible for keeping the Lead Designer and direct Supervisors updated on any and all concerns relating to their respective assignments and discipline;
Other various project responsibilities as required.

Qualifications (Knowledge, Skills and Abilities):

  • Requires a High school diploma or equivalent;
  • Requires a minimum of ten (10) years of directly relevant design experience relating to the Greenfield Deepwater Upstream Oil & Gas market;
  • Must have advanced working knowledge of Company 2D and 3D software. (PDMS/ E3D, and AutoCAD);
  • Expert knowledge of the Design/Model Module, Paragon/Specon Module, Draft/Draw Module, IsoDraft Module and Global;
  • Requires knowledge and the ability to work with MS Office Suite of products (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Access);
